如何以太坊钱包的磁盘空间使用:实用指南与技

            以太坊(Ethereum)是当今最受欢迎的区块链平台之一,随着其智能合约、去中心化应用(DApp)和非同质化代币(NFT)的流行,越来越多的用户和开发者开始使用以太坊钱包。然而,这种钱包在使用过程中往往需要占用相对较大的磁盘空间,特别是当钱包需要同步整个区块链数据时。本文将探讨如何以太坊钱包的磁盘空间使用,以及在这一过程中可能遇到的一些问题和解决方案。

            以太坊钱包概述

            以太坊钱包是一种用于管理以太坊和ERC-20代币的工具,它允许用户发送、接收和管理加密资产。用户在设置以太坊钱包时,可以选择多种类型的钱包,包括热钱包(网络连接)和冷钱包(离线存储)。根据不同的需求,用户可以选择合适的钱包类型。

            使用以太坊钱包的第一步通常是需要下载和同步以太坊区块链数据,这个过程会占用大量的磁盘空间。完整节点通常需要300GB以上的存储空间,这对许多用户而言是一个挑战。

            磁盘空间的基本需求

            以太坊要求用户在运行完整节点时下载整个区块链的历史数据。随着网络的渗透,区块链的大小也在不断增长,因此用户必须确保有足够的磁盘空间来存储这些数据。不仅如此,钱包的数据库也会随着用户活动的增多而增大。

            对于大多数普通用户来说,运行完整节点并不是必要的,他们可以选择轻节点、在线钱包或者硬件钱包等替代方案。这些替代品在功能上可能有所欠缺,但却能显著减少磁盘空间的需求。

            提高以太坊钱包性能的技巧

            为了减少以太坊钱包对磁盘空间的占用,用户可以采取以下几种方法:

            1. 使用轻钱包:轻钱包不需要下载所有的区块链数据,而仅下载必要的信息,可以大大减少磁盘使用。
            2. 选择状态节点:与完整节点不同,状态节点只需要下载当前区块链的状态,而不是完整的历史数据。
            3. 定期清理和:定期清理未使用的数据和缓存,有助于释放磁盘空间。
            4. 利用云存储:如果条件允许,可以将钱包数据转移到外部硬盘或者云存储。
            5. 使用分层钱包:分层确定性钱包(HD钱包)可以有效减少存储需求,并增强安全性。

            常见问题解答

            在以太坊钱包的磁盘空间时,用户可能会遇到一些实际问题,以下是五个常见问题及其详细解答。

            1. 为什么我的以太坊钱包需要这么多的磁盘空间?

            以太坊钱包需要大量磁盘空间,主要是因为它需要存储整个区块链的数据。以太坊区块链是一个去中心化的公共账本,记录了所有的交易历史和智能合约的状态,随着时间的推移,这些数据会不断增加。

            具体来说,以太坊需要存储区块链的所有区块数据以及相应的头信息。这些块不仅包含交易的详细信息,还包括每个交易的状态。随着越多的交易被记录,所需的磁盘空间也就越多。此外,如果用户是完整节点,那么他们的本地数据副本会包含最新的区块链快照,因此更加占用空间。

            如果用户使用的是轻钱包或状态节点,这些钱包只会下载当前区块链的状态,而不会储存历史交易记录,从而减少磁盘空间的消耗。

            2. 如何释放以太坊钱包中占用的磁盘空间?

            释放以太坊钱包占用的磁盘空间有几种方法:

            1. 使用轻钱包:考虑转移到轻钱包,以避免下载和存储整条区块链。
            2. 删除多余的数据:有些以太坊钱包提供了清理交易记录和缓存的选项。定期检查并清理未使用的数据,可以有效减少使用的磁盘空间。
            3. 迁移数据:将钱包数据迁移至外部存储设备,可以在保证钱包安全的前提下,释放电脑内部存储空间。
            4. 定期备份:定期对钱包进行备份,并清理旧的备份文件,这些备份可能会占用大量额外的空间。

            此外,用户还可以通过钱包的设置来进行空间管理,比如调整缓存大小等。重要的是,用户在进行任何清理操作前,确保进行了必要的数据备份,以免丢失重要的资产信息。

            3. 轻钱包和完整节点有什么区别?

            轻钱包和完整节点(全节点)在功能和存储需求上存在显著区别:

            完整节点指的是自行下载和存储完整区块链数据的节点。完整节点运行智能合约并支持交易验证,同时能够为网络提供数据。完整节点的优点是用户能够完全控制他们的资产,无需依赖第三方服务。然鹅,缺点是其对存储的要求非常高。

            轻钱包则是一种只下载交易历史中的部分数据的节点。轻钱包不需要存储整个区块链数据,而是通过获取区块链的最新状态来发送或接收交易。由于轻钱包不存储所有历史数据,因此占用的磁盘空间显著少得多,适合普通用户使用。

            在安全性上,完整节点相对更高,因为用户拥有所有的数据。而轻钱包虽然方便,但会有一定的安全风险,用户还是需要谨慎选择信任的轻钱包提供商,以防止数据丢失和安全问题。

            4. 是否有云钱包可以减小磁盘空间使用?

            是的,云钱包因其便捷性而受到许多用户的青睐。云钱包不需要用户在本地下载完整区块链数据,数据存储在人们可信赖的云服务器上。这意味着用户只需通过互联网连接,就能随时随地访问其钱包和资产,而不必担心存储要求。

            云钱包的优点在于显著减少了本地设备的存储使用,因为用户不需要在本地保存所有的交易和区块数据。这不仅节省了磁盘空间,还可能减少数据丢失的风险,因为大多数云服务提供商都会有额外的备份机制。

            然而,使用云钱包也存在风险,最主要的是安全性问题。如果云服务提供商遭到攻击,用户的数据可能会受到威胁,甚至资金安全也无法得到保证。因此,在选择云钱包时,需要检查其安全机制及用户评价,以降低安全风险。

            5. 如何判断我的以太坊钱包是否运行正常?

            要判断以太坊钱包是否运行正常,可以通过以下几方面进行检查:

            1. 同步状态:查看钱包是否与网络的区块链同步,通常钱包页面会有相关指示。若长时间未同步,则可能需要检验网络连接。
            2. 交易记录:检查之前的交易历史是否完整,确认是否能正常发送和接收以太币及ERC-20代币。
            3. 链上查询:通过区块链浏览器(例如Etherscan)检查交易是否成功验证、状态正确,以确保钱包的正常功能。
            4. 磁盘空间:定期查看磁盘使用情况,确保有足够空间供钱包使用,倘若空间较小,可能会影响钱包性能。
            5. 备份情况:确保定期对钱包进行备份,以便在出现意外情况时及时恢复数据。

            定期检查这些因素,可以帮助用户确保他们的以太坊钱包安全且运行正常,从而保护他们的资产不受潜在风险的影响。

            综上所述,以太坊钱包的磁盘空间使用是一个关乎用户体验和资产安全的重要话题。通过了解各种钱包选择、定期维护和使用各种技巧,用户可以有效管理他们的磁盘空间,同时更好地迎接以太坊生态系统的不断发展。

            
                    
                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                          
                                  

                          leave a reply